How much does it cost to hire a HVAC contractor in Springfield, Massachusetts?
In Massachusetts, hvac replacement typically runs $6,900 to $15,000 when you hire a pro, and about $3,300 to $7,700 if you do it yourself. Springfield prices track the Massachusetts range, with larger metros toward the high end. Size it to your own home with our free calculator.
